What are Electric Cars?
Electric cars, also known as electric vehicles (EVs), utilize a rechargeable battery instead of an internal combustion engine to power the vehicle. The battery is charged by plugging it into a charging station or a standard power outlet, allowing the vehicle to run on electric power alone.

Disadvantages of Electric Cars
Upfront Cost
Electric cars are generally more expensive upfront than gasoline-powered cars. However, over time, electric cars can be more cost-effective due to lower fuel and maintenance costs.
Range Anxiety
Electric cars have limited range compared to gasoline-powered cars, typically between 150-300 miles per charge. This limited range can cause range anxiety, where drivers worry about running out of charge, particularly on longer trips.
Charging Time
Charging an electric car can take several hours, depending on the battery size and the charging station’s power. Fast-charging stations can charge a car in as little as 20-30 minutes, but they are not as common as Level 2 charging stations.
Charging Infrastructure
While Lincoln has a growing network of charging stations, they are not yet as ubiquitous as gas stations. This can make it challenging to find a charging station while on the road, particularly in rural areas.
Battery Life
The battery life of an electric car can deteriorate over time, leading to reduced range and performance. Additionally, replacing the battery can be expensive and time-consuming.
Noise
Electric cars are quieter than gas-powered cars, which can be a benefit to some drivers. However, this can also pose a safety risk since pedestrians and cyclists may not hear the car approaching.
Power Grid Reliance
Electric cars rely on the power grid, which can pose a risk if there is a power outage or blackout. Additionally, the increased demand for electricity from electric cars can strain the power grid, leading to higher energy costs.

8. How does maintenance differ for electric cars?
Electric cars require less maintenance than gasoline-powered cars since there are no oil changes or spark plug replacements needed. However, electric cars still require regular maintenance, such as brake and tire replacements.
9. Can electric cars be charged in cold weather?
Yes, electric cars can be charged in cold weather. However, the battery’s range may be reduced in cold weather, leading to more frequent charges. Additionally, charging an electric car in cold weather may take longer than in mild temperatures.
10. How do I find a charging station?
You can find a charging station using various apps and websites, such as PlugShare and ChargePoint. Additionally, many electric cars have built-in navigation systems that can help you locate charging stations.
11. Can I take an electric car on a road trip?
Yes, you can take an electric car on a road trip. However, you will need to plan your route carefully to ensure that you have access to charging stations along the way.
12. Do electric cars require special tires?
Electric cars do not require special tires. However, they may benefit from low-rolling-resistance tires, which can increase the car’s range and improve fuel efficiency.
13. What happens if an electric car runs out of charge?
If an electric car runs out of charge, it will stop running, just like a gasoline-powered car that runs out of gas. However, electric cars may have a reserve charge that allows them to drive a short distance to a charging station.
